THE IMPORTANCE OF DOWRY PAYMENT WEDNESDAY MAY 24 TEXT: GENESIS 34: 8 – 12 Key Verse: “And Shechem said unto her father and unto her brethren, Let me find grace in your eyes, and what ye shall say unto me I will give” Genesis 34: 11 Once parental consent has been released upon you and your fiancée, marriage can take place after courtship and other formalities; dowry can be paid later. Sometimes dowry is not required. So, if consent has been given, and you are together as husband and wife after following due process, then you can come and pay later when you have. Don’t say later, I didn’t pay your dowry, so go back to your father’s house. The father has released her, so she’s released, dowry or no dowry. All that is required is to pay later because you married her on credit. It’s like, you bought a car on credit, it became yours and you are using the car and it is getting old now, and it has developed some noise and you say you want to return the car, who are you returning it to? It is the payment of the money that remains. You got the woman and now she’s aging and children everywhere and you say you want to return her, to who? Check your marriage, is there parental consent, have they released that woman to you truly? Maybe you eloped before but your in-laws have even visited, prayed and blessed you in the house, you ran away before but he forgave you and said I have forgiven you, I want my daughter to marry, stay together any time you are ready for dowry payment you can come. The matter has finished. All that is required now is money. If you miss heaven, it will be because you are a borrower that does not pay. Again dowry may be required of her by her parents. Ask the parents what do they want you to give, let them give you their list, let them charge you; if they charge one million naira, you may have to plead because it’s an open market. You plead, you beg and you woman, join in begging, you know which person to influence among your parents. What if they demand for alcohol, cigarette and any of these abominable things by the scripture? You cannot give anything that is corrupt: alcohol, cigarette or any such thing. Make sure things are followed in holiness and righteousness, no immorality before marriage. However tough the in-laws are, they’ll eventually bow if the woman is from God for your life.
